From WikiChip
Difference between revisions of "movidius/myriad/ma1102"
< movidius‎ | myriad

(ma1102)
 
 
(4 intermediate revisions by the same user not shown)
Line 9: Line 9:
 
|market 2=Mobile
 
|market 2=Mobile
 
|first announced=2009
 
|first announced=2009
|first launched=2009
+
|first launched=2010
 
|family=Myriad
 
|family=Myriad
 
|series=1
 
|series=1
Line 22: Line 22:
 
|technology=TSMC
 
|technology=TSMC
 
|word size=32 bit
 
|word size=32 bit
|core count=1
+
|core count=9
|thread count=1
+
|thread count=9
 +
|v core=1.2 V
 +
|v io=2.5 V
 
}}
 
}}
'''Myriad 1 MA1102''' was a vision processing [[accelerator]] designed by [[Movidius]] and introduced in [[2009]] designed to serve as an advanced real-time video editing accelerator for smartphones. The MA1102 is an identical variant of the {{\\|MA1101}} but had added high-quality imaging and source effects, including support for the Dolby and DTS standards.
+
'''Myriad 1 MA1102''' was a vision processing [[accelerator]] designed by [[Movidius]] and introduced in [[2010]] designed to serve as an advanced real-time video editing accelerator for smartphones. The MA1102 is an identical variant of the {{\\|MA1101}} but had added high-quality imaging and source effects, including support for the Dolby and DTS standards.
 +
 
 +
== Overview ==
 +
[[File:ma1102 multimedia.png|right|thumb|Multimedia]]
 +
The MA1102 is a vision [[accelerator]] designed to work alongside a main host processors, typically in a mobile or embedded device. The chip itself independently communicates with the camera input and does the processing internally.
 +
 
 +
[[File:movidius myriad arch.jpg|500px]]
 +
 
 +
The MA1102 consists of a single [[SPARC]] {{sparc|V8}} [[LEON3]] core which is used for management and control and eight {{movidius|SHAVE v2.0|l=arch}} core which are the workhorse of this chip. Each core has 128 KiB of cache. The eight SHAVE cores together are capable of 20GFLOPS of processing power at just a few 100s milliwatt of power.
 +
 
 +
[[File:movidius ma1000 silicon platform.png|600px]]
 +
 
 +
== Camera Capture ==
 +
* Up to WVGA H.264 Capture @ 30fps
 +
* Video Stabilization to Reduce Camcorder Shake
 +
* Auto White Balance, Color Balance
 +
* Low Light Compensation
 +
 
 +
* HD Video Playback
 +
** Up to WVGA H.264 Video Playback @ 30fps
 +
** Quality Multi-frame Upscaling to WVGA, VGA, 720p
 +
** High Quality Downscaling to WVGA, VGA, QVGA
 +
** Video Noise Removal – De-Noise, De-Flicker
 +
** Up to HD 720p Video Output to External HDMI Driver Chip
 +
 
 +
* Video Enhancements
 +
** High quality upsscaling to WVGA and 720p
 +
** High quality downscaling to WVGA
 +
** Frame rate enhancement from 15fps to 30fps
 +
 
 +
*High Resolution Camera Capture
 +
** 12MP Still Image Capture
 +
** 12MP Continuous Capture @ 5fps (JPEG encoding)
 +
** Image Stabilization Reduces Camera Shake
 +
** Auto White Balance, Color Balance, Light Balance
 +
** Sharpness Enhancement
 +
 
 +
* Image Effects
 +
* Movidius lists the following image effects:
 +
** (Auto) White Balance, Brightness, Contrast, Auto Tone, Saturation, Sharpness, Light Balance, De-Noise Crop, Rotate, Pan, Merge, Object Overlay, Saturation, High Res. Digital Zoom, Color Themes, Sepia, Tint
 +
** Fun Suite: LOMO, Cartoon, Antique Movie
 +
 
 +
* Video Effects
 +
 
 +
* High Res Zoom to any Non Center Location, High Quality Slow Motion, Light Balance
 +
* Color Effects: Sepia, Greyscale, Negative, Edges, XRay, Color Themes, etc.
 +
* White Balance, Saturation, Brightness, Contrast, Sharpness, etc.
 +
* Clip Add/Trim/Add Effect, Video Transitions, Image/Text Overlay, etc.
 +
* Creative Suite: Newspaper, Cartoon, etc.
 +
 
 +
== Extensions ==
 +
* Host Memory Bus (master and slave): 8-bit / 16-bit / 32-bit
 +
* Video Output Formats:
 +
** 8-24 bit RGB, CPU (Intel/Motorola), BT656 ...
 +
** 24bpp, 16M colors, resolutions up to 2048x2048
 +
** Video support for 4 layers of video and graphics
 +
* External TV Support
 +
** Video Output to External HDMI Driver Chip
 +
* Multiple I2S (Master/Slave) stereo audio channels
 +
** Independent sampling frequencies
 +
* Standard interfaces
 +
** I2C, UART, SDIO, SPI
 +
* Configurable bidirectional GPIO lanes

Latest revision as of 21:59, 12 March 2018

Edit Values
Myriad 1 MA1102
General Info
DesignerMovidius
ManufacturerTSMC
Model NumberMA1102
MarketEmbedded, Mobile
Introduction2009 (announced)
2010 (launched)
General Specs
FamilyMyriad
Series1
Frequency180 MHz
Microarchitecture
ISASPARC V8 (SPARC), SHAVE (SHAVE)
MicroarchitectureLEON3, SHAVE v2.0
Process65 nm
TechnologyTSMC
Word Size32 bit
Cores9
Threads9
Electrical
Vcore1.2 V
VI/O2.5 V

Myriad 1 MA1102 was a vision processing accelerator designed by Movidius and introduced in 2010 designed to serve as an advanced real-time video editing accelerator for smartphones. The MA1102 is an identical variant of the MA1101 but had added high-quality imaging and source effects, including support for the Dolby and DTS standards.

Overview[edit]

Multimedia

The MA1102 is a vision accelerator designed to work alongside a main host processors, typically in a mobile or embedded device. The chip itself independently communicates with the camera input and does the processing internally.

movidius myriad arch.jpg

The MA1102 consists of a single SPARC V8 LEON3 core which is used for management and control and eight SHAVE v2.0 core which are the workhorse of this chip. Each core has 128 KiB of cache. The eight SHAVE cores together are capable of 20GFLOPS of processing power at just a few 100s milliwatt of power.

movidius ma1000 silicon platform.png

Camera Capture[edit]

  • Up to WVGA H.264 Capture @ 30fps
  • Video Stabilization to Reduce Camcorder Shake
  • Auto White Balance, Color Balance
  • Low Light Compensation
  • HD Video Playback
    • Up to WVGA H.264 Video Playback @ 30fps
    • Quality Multi-frame Upscaling to WVGA, VGA, 720p
    • High Quality Downscaling to WVGA, VGA, QVGA
    • Video Noise Removal – De-Noise, De-Flicker
    • Up to HD 720p Video Output to External HDMI Driver Chip
  • Video Enhancements
    • High quality upsscaling to WVGA and 720p
    • High quality downscaling to WVGA
    • Frame rate enhancement from 15fps to 30fps
  • High Resolution Camera Capture
    • 12MP Still Image Capture
    • 12MP Continuous Capture @ 5fps (JPEG encoding)
    • Image Stabilization Reduces Camera Shake
    • Auto White Balance, Color Balance, Light Balance
    • Sharpness Enhancement
  • Image Effects
  • Movidius lists the following image effects:
    • (Auto) White Balance, Brightness, Contrast, Auto Tone, Saturation, Sharpness, Light Balance, De-Noise Crop, Rotate, Pan, Merge, Object Overlay, Saturation, High Res. Digital Zoom, Color Themes, Sepia, Tint
    • Fun Suite: LOMO, Cartoon, Antique Movie
  • Video Effects
  • High Res Zoom to any Non Center Location, High Quality Slow Motion, Light Balance
  • Color Effects: Sepia, Greyscale, Negative, Edges, XRay, Color Themes, etc.
  • White Balance, Saturation, Brightness, Contrast, Sharpness, etc.
  • Clip Add/Trim/Add Effect, Video Transitions, Image/Text Overlay, etc.
  • Creative Suite: Newspaper, Cartoon, etc.

Extensions[edit]

  • Host Memory Bus (master and slave): 8-bit / 16-bit / 32-bit
  • Video Output Formats:
    • 8-24 bit RGB, CPU (Intel/Motorola), BT656 ...
    • 24bpp, 16M colors, resolutions up to 2048x2048
    • Video support for 4 layers of video and graphics
  • External TV Support
    • Video Output to External HDMI Driver Chip
  • Multiple I2S (Master/Slave) stereo audio channels
    • Independent sampling frequencies
  • Standard interfaces
    • I2C, UART, SDIO, SPI
  • Configurable bidirectional GPIO lanes
base frequency180 MHz (0.18 GHz, 180,000 kHz) +
core count9 +
core voltage1.2 V (12 dV, 120 cV, 1,200 mV) +
designerMovidius +
familyMyriad +
first announced2009 +
first launched2010 +
full page namemovidius/myriad/ma1102 +
instance ofmicroprocessor +
io voltage2.5 V (25 dV, 250 cV, 2,500 mV) +
isaSPARC V8 + and SHAVE +
isa familySPARC + and SHAVE +
ldate2010 +
manufacturerTSMC +
market segmentEmbedded + and Mobile +
microarchitectureLEON3 + and SHAVE v2.0 +
model numberMA1102 +
nameMyriad 1 MA1102 +
process65 nm (0.065 μm, 6.5e-5 mm) +
series1 +
thread count9 +
word size32 bit (4 octets, 8 nibbles) +